This is an enjoyable and engaging stand alone romance, which kept me happily turning the pages. Jasmine Hayes runs her company, ‘Divine Events’ and organises events for the social elite. Meanwhile, James is a drunk who has a string of bad business decisions behind him, however, he also comes from the rich Conners family, who are the closest thing to royalty in New England. Two years ago he was told to sort his life out, and now James is about to marry Cadence, and then will be able to get the money he needs to start a new venture. The only problem is that when James meets Jasmine, his fiancé’s best friend and their wedding planner, he recognises her as the woman who he has not stopped thinking about since meeting her.

Jasmine, can’t believe the man that her best friend is marrying is the one who kissed her silly and swept her off her feet. What Jasmine does not know is that James and Cadence have a secret contract, which states they will have a mutually agreeable and quick divorce. I loved the main characters, as they are all likeable and relatable in their own ways. Their relationships come across as very realistic, and they all brought something different to the story. The chemistry between James and Jasmine really came through in the narrative, but I also loved the dynamics between all three main characters. This was a lighthearted and heartwarming romance which had a HEA.

My Pearl Heart by J.N. Sheats
Genre – Contemporary Romance
Page Count – 88
Cover Designer – J.N. Sheats

Jasmine Hayes has been running from her memories for years, throwing herself into school, friends, and her business, Divine Events. Quick witted, hot tempered, and a brillaint businesswoman, Jasmine divides her time between organizing events for the social elite, and catering to her best friend’s extreme personality. Life is as it should be, until James Conner sweeps her off her feet. Literally, kissing her silly before announcing his engagement to her best friend.

James Conner comes from a family full of rich and successful people. The Conners are the closest thing to royalty in New England, but James isn’t like the rest of them. A drunk with a string of poor business choices, he used to spend his days wallowing in self-pity. That was two years ago, now he’s determined to right his life. First step, marry Cadence. Second, get the money he needs to start his new venture, and a quick–mutual–divorce per their contract, but there’s an unforeseen problem–Jasmine–the spicy redhead that set him straight two years ago. The woman that has been on his thoughts ever since she kicked him out of his parent’s anniversary dinner.

Can James wait that long to have Jasmine? What will she think about his and Cadence’s insane contract?

This is a stand alone story with a HEA

J.N. Sheats is an artist turned author. Living in Maryland with six wild cats, and her husband, J.N. spends her days designing book covers and teasers for other authors. At night she is at the mercy of her demanding characters, and their wild fantasies.

Dark Paranormal Fantasy is her preferred genre of writing, but anything is game. Maybe even a lovely romance novel or two in the near future.

When not writing, designing, or drawing, J.N. spends her time doing a host of other activities. Including: gardening, jewelry making, cooking, and watching far too much television.
